See the "CONTACT" section at the end of this document +to find out how to reach me. + +GalaXa is a space game based loosely on "Galaga," an arcade classic +released by NAMCO in the 1981. GalaXa is an X-Window game written in +C in my spare time. + + +STORY +----- +You are a lone starfighter pilot battling the evil race of +GalaXans, giant bug-like creatures who have been meanacing the +peaceful inhabitants of your solar system. + + +REQUIREMENTS +------------ +GalaXa requires an X-Server with at least 4-bit greyscale depth. +16-bit or higher color depth is recommended, but hopefully shouldn't +be required. If you have problems running the game, please e-mail me +and I'll see if I can help: kendrick@zippy.sonoma.edu + + +INSTALLING +---------- +To install GalaXa, simply type: + + make + +The "makefile" contains defaults which you may need to change. +(Most likely, you may need to change the "XLIB" and "CFLAGS" to +conform to your system's setup.) + + +RUNNING +------- +You can run GalaXa by simply typing + + galaxa + +Some useful command line arguements are, in this order: + + display - for example, "$DISPLAY" or "computer:0.0" + level - for example, "-l10" or "-L5" + greyscale - use "-grey" or "-g" + sound - use "-sound" or "-s" + +Some example calls: + + ./galaxa $DISPLAY -l15 -grey + galaxa home.computer.net:0.0 & + galaxa my.server:0.0 -l3 & + galaxa -sound + +etc. + + +After a moment, a screen will appear with a count-down from 10 to 1, +the text "ONE MOMENT", and a percentage bar. + +At this point, the game is loading all of the graphics onto your X-Server. +Once the counter reaches 0 and the percentage bar reaches "full", +the title screen will appear. + + +THE TITLE SCREEN +---------------- +The title screen will display the title graphic, credits, and the +currently-selected level. Use the following keystrokes: + +[L] - Select the next higher level. +[K] - Select the previous level. +[Space] - Begin the game at the selected level. +[Q] - Quit the program. +[1] - Next title screen +[2] - Jump to high scores title screen + +If you wait for a few moments, a number of useful help screens will appear, +explaining things like what each object in the game is. The high score +will also appear. + +If you wish to page through these manually (rather than wait), you can +press [1] repeatedly to get to each screen, and eventually back to the +title display. Press [2] to get to the high score screen. + +If you press [L] or [K] to change the level, and you are viewing a help +screen, the title display will reappear. + +If you press [Space] to begin a game, and you are viewing a help screen, +the game will begin. + + +THE GAME SCREEN +--------------- +The game screen looks similar to this text representation: + + _________________________________________ + | Score: 00000 Level: 01 Lives: 03 | <-- Game status + | | + | X X | + | | + | % % % % % | + | | <-- Evil GalaXan aliens + | & & & & & | + | | + | | + | | + | | + | | + | | + | | + | A | <-- Your fighter + |_________________________________________| + + +PLAYING THE GAME +---------------- +Each level begins with you warping forward in space. + +After you've dropped out of hyperspace, the aliens begin coming onto the +screen and taking their place at the top. + +Note: Some aliens are only escorts, and will abruptly turn towards the +bottom of the screen and attack! After they've left the screen, +they will not come back. Try to shoot them for extra points, and +definitely watch out not to get killed! + +You control your ship by moving it left and right and firing bullets +up towards the aliens. + +The aliens move side to side (or in other directions) at the top of the +screen and occasionally fly down to attack you. They fire bullets down +towards you when they're attacking. + + +LIVES AND GAME OVER +------------------- +You start the game with 3 ships (lives). + +If you are hit by an alien's bullet or by an actual alien, you loose +a ship. + +When the number of lives reaches 0, the game is over. + +Note: During game over, you can see your "Hit-Ratio." This is the +percentage of hits to shots. (For example, if you fired 1000 bullets +during the game, but only 500 of them hit, your hit-ratio would be 50.00%.) + +Press [Q] to quit from the "Game Over" screen. If you beat one of the +10 high scores and/or high levels, or you beat the high hit-ratio, you +will be prompted for your initials (for each). + +When the game returns to the title-screen mode, the high score screen +will appear first, with your high scores highlighted. + + +KEYBOARD CONTROLS +----------------- +THe keyboard controls in the game are simple: + +[Left Arrow] - Slide ship left. (Release to stop sliding.) +[Right Arrow] - Slide ship right. (Release to stop sliding.) +[Space] - Fire a bullet. +[P] - Pause/unpause. +[Q] - Quit. Return to the title screen. + + +MEET THE ALIENS +--------------- +There are three categories of aliens. (See the game's help screens to +see what they look like.) + + MASTERS + * There are always two, at the very top of the screen. + * They look like flies. + * When they attack, they are often escorted by the alien just below + them. + * When they reach the bottom, they sometimes fire a "tractor beam." + If you hit this beam, your ship will begin spinning up towards + the alien, and will be captured by it! See below for more info. + * Masters require TWO shots to be killed! (They change color + when shot the first time.) + * Masters are worth 250 points. + + GUARDS + * There are always five, making a row just below the Masters. + * They look like beetles. (There are two styles of Guards.) + * They often escort Masters down during attacks. + * Guards are worth 100 points. + + DRONES + * There are five or ten, making up one or two rows just below the + Guards. + * Sometimes they are bee-like, sometimes they are ant-like. + * Drones are worth 50 points. + + SUPER-MASTERS + * These are gigantic Masters which appear on every 10th level. + * They require many many hits to be destroyed! Watch out! + * Like regular Masters, they can capture your ship. (See below.) + * Super-Masters are worth lots of points! + + +GETTING CAPTURED +---------------- +If you allow your ship to be captured by a Master or Super-Master, +your ship will be in their control! (It will appear red.) + +Note: You loose a life when this happens, so definitely avoid getting +captured if you only have one life left! + +When the Master attacks, the captured ship will follow. If you can, +try shooting the Master (but NOT the ship) while it's attacking. +If you do so, the captured ship will be freed (it will change from +red to white) and will fly down towards your current ship. + +When both ships touch, they will dock and you will control both ships +at once. This provides both double firepower (you shoot two shots at +once) AND extra protection (if one ship is destroyed, the other remains +in action)! + +Note: If you destroy the Master while it is NOT attacking (sitting in it's +"home" postion at the top of the screen), the captured ship will NOT +be freed. It will instead take the place of the Master and fly down to +attack you itself! It can even capture your ship, like a Master can. +Be careful! + + +FUTURE RELEASES +--------------- +This is the first beta release of GalaXa.
